Output 5b8dd09fd7faa9ba28fa9d3c8ae7a7ab777027e2a0a299a820266d198f59b2f9:4

value
17753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29526d2e37a473792bf9fe72f5935f51e4ecbebb OP_EQUAL
address
35TWNW3F9ErZHe5y4MJRJWf6H4cJtMLhaK
transaction
5b8dd09fd7faa9ba28fa9d3c8ae7a7ab777027e2a0a299a820266d198f59b2f9
confirmations
340652
spent
true